§58‑23‑35.  Immunity of administrators and boards of trustees.

There is no liability on thepart of and no cause of action arises against any board of trustees establishedor administrator appointed pursuant to G.S. 58‑23‑10, theirrepresentatives, or any pool, its members, or its employees, agents,contractors, or subcontractors for any good faith action taken by them in theperformance of their powers and duties in creating or administering any poolunder this Article. (1985 (Reg. Sess., 1986), c. 1027, s. 26.)
